How To Use Access Keys
Windows Systems
- Microsoft Internet Explorer 4 - Press the "Alt" key and the relevant letter at the same time.
- Microsoft Internet Explorer 5 and 6 - Press the "Alt" key and the relevant letter, then press the "Enter" key.
- Netscape 6 or later and Mozilla - Press the "Alt" key and the relevant letter at the same time.
Macintosh Systems
- Press the "Ctrl" key and the relevant letter at the same time.
Adjusting the size of the screen font
Most modern browsers support adjusting font sizes by pressing the following keys on your keyboard.
- PC: press ctrl+ to increase font size and ctrl- to decrease font size
- MAC: press command+ to increase font size and command- to decrease font size
